What companies run services between Bath, England and River Frome, Wiltshire, England?

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from Bath Spa to Freshford hourly. Tickets cost £4–7 and the journey takes 11 min. Alternatively, First Bristol, Bath & the West operates a bus from Guildhall to Wheatsheaf Junction every 15 minutes, and the journey takes 22 min. Two other operators also service this route.
